Research Notes:
tenant of Roger de Bully [Ref: CP IX p543]
1086: Domesday tenant of Roger de Bully [Ref: Keats-Rohan DD p617, Keats-Rohan
DP p336]
1088: witnessed the foundation of the priory of Blyth, Notts, by Roger de
Bully [Ref: CP IX p543]
heir was his brother Paine [Ref: CP IX p543]
